Ogun Assembly Demands Urgent Relief for Windstorm Victims

...Summons Special Duties Commissioner

Concerned about the widespread devastation caused by recent natural disasters in Ogun State, the State House of Assembly has intensified efforts to ensure swift intervention and relief for affected communities.

During an interactive session at the Assembly Complex, Oke-Mosan, Abeokuta, lawmakers engaged the State Commissioner for Education, Science and Technology, Prof. Abayomi Arigbabu, along with management teams from other relevant agencies, to assess the extent of damage and discuss lasting solutions.

Led by the Majority Leader, Yusuf Sherif, the lawmakers emphasized the urgent need for immediate government intervention, insisting that relief efforts should not be delayed.

They also extended an invitation to the State Commissioner for Special Duties and Inter-Governmental Affairs for a follow-up meeting scheduled for Thursday, March 6, 2025, at 12 noon.

The meeting will focus on strengthening emergency response measures for communities affected by rainstorms and fire outbreaks.

The lawmakers stressed the importance of a proactive approach to disaster management. “The relevant agencies must act swiftly to provide immediate succor to victims,” they said, stating the need for an efficient and coordinated relief effort.

Responding to concerns raised, the Commissioner for Education, Science and Technology, Prof. Arigbabu, assured that the State Government was already addressing the repairs of school buildings damaged by the windstorm.

He noted that under the Ogun REHAB scheme, the Ministry had commenced maintenance and rehabilitation efforts to prevent structural collapses.

Similarly, the Director of the State Emergency Management Agency (SEMA), Mr. Wale Sonde, highlighted the agency’s ongoing efforts in providing relief materials to affected residents across the state.

Other officials present at the meeting included the Permanent Secretary, Teaching Service Commission, Mrs. Melutia Ogunremi, and the Board Secretary, State Universal Basic Education Board (SUBEB), Dr. Mukail Lawal.
